The phrase "an ostensibly" is grammatically correct and can be used in written English.
It is often used to introduce a statement or action that appears to be one thing, but may actually be something different. Here is an example sentence: "An ostensibly innocent bystander, he watched as the events of the day unfolded before his eyes."
